  • Adobe Premiere Pro CS5 Dynamic Link not working as part of Production Premium CS5

    I ran into a situation whereby I recently reinstalled my Production Premium CS 5 onto a new computer and when trying to run the Dynamic Link out of Premiere PRO CS 5 to create a new After Effects composition, After Effects tried to start up but then crashed with the error that Production Premium was needed.
    Yet, I had Production Premium CS5.
    (Note:  The crash didn't occur when I simply tried to use Dynamic Link without anything selected in my project or timeline - but the moment I had a clip in my timeline selected to work on it, the dynamic link would not work as covered above.)
    In checking around the forums I found various answers to this problem such as rebooting the computer, reformatting hard drives and/or whatever.  This all may be correct.
    However, as I just went through that nightmare, I was not anxious to do that again.  So, I called Adobe and the following solution solved the matter in 5 minutes:
    1. Close all your other Adobe applications such as After Effects.
    2. Open up Premiere Pro CS5 and then deactivate it by going to HELP>DEACTIVATE and then Permanently Deactivate.
    3.Close the application and restart Premiere Pro CS5.
    4.Then do the same to Activate it.
    5. Have your serial number handy and plug it in when prompted.
    Solved it right away and worked beautifully.
    Not to say there couldn't be more complicated situations, but the above worked and the simpler the better is good for me. And I thought I would post this in case anyone else ran into this problem.

  • Overriding automatic replacing of AE projects with incremental file names in Dynamic Link (CS5.5)

    Hi everyone,
    I've been searching all corners of the internet for an answer to this question including this forum and the Adobe help documents, so I apologize in advance if this question has been asked before.
    First off, we're using Premiere Pro CS5.5. We have recently switched from a FCP6 to a Premiere workflow and we're really enjoying the Adobe Dynamic Link feature. Unfortunately, we've discovered a bit of a problem with our workflow.
    All our AE projects are named something like "heb_alef_01.aep", "heb_alef_02.aep", "kor_hhh_01.aep", "kor_hhh_02.aep". These don't correspond to different versions of the same videos, but rather ...01.aep is video #1 and ...02.aep is video #2.
    You can probably see how this causes a problem when it runs into Premiere's feature of automatically updating project files if it finds an exact filename match in that directory with a higher number at the end. If I try to import "kor_hhh_01.aep" it will instead give me "kor_hhh_02.aep", for example.
    I noticed that in CS6, a checkbox has been added to the Preferences pane which will prevent this from automatically happening, but I wanted to know if any options exist for Premiere CS5.5 users. If necessary we can adjust our file naming structure, but I really didn't want to deal with the far-reaching implications of that if possible.
    Thank you in advance for any help you can offer.

    Are each of these different AE project files pointing to clips within the same Pr project?  (Seems like that may be the case..?)  If so, it is highly recommended to only have 1 AE project per Pr project, and just have that include all of the comps corresponsing to the clips in Pr.  Then, when re-opening the Pr file, click on "edit original" on any of the DL clips which will open your AE project, and any subsequent DLs that you send over will stay in your original AE project.

  • Issues with transferring CS5 project with Adobe Dynamic Links to CS5.5

    Hello all!
    Has anybody encountered the issue with transferring CS5 projects with Adobe Dynamic Links to CS5.5?
    When I try to do it the movie hangs on at some clips which are AE compositions...
    The CS5 project works perfectly.
    All AE CS5 compositions are transerred to AE CS5.5 compositions.
    All 'old' Adobe Dynamic Links in Pr CS5.5 project are changed to 'new' ones (I mean, links to AE CS5 composition changed to links to AE CS5.5 compositions)...
    Any help will be appreciated

    Tried to play around. Realised that a solution should be somewhere around re-rendering, 'cos linked AE compositions were always displayed in yellow as if they were original footages - even I changed a composition within AE, just transitions, if they were, changed to red in Pr Pro sequence...
    However, I was unable to re-render 'Entire Work Area' even after deleting all Render Files, just 'Effects in Work Area'...
    Then I simply created a new sequence and copied and pasted all the clips from original sequence. Now I was allowed to 'Render Entire Work Area'.
    Voilà!
